Common Emergency Locksmith Problems We See in Buckeye Homes
- Key turns but bolt won’t retract. Buckeye routinely records some of the highest temperatures in the entire Phoenix metro - sustained 115°F-plus summer days cause metal deadbolt bolts to bind in thermally expanded steel door frames. We see this surge every July and August, especially in new Sun Valley Parkway homes where builder-grade hardware has tighter tolerances.
- Smart lock keypad failure. Extreme heat corrodes battery contacts in electronic locks, leaving owners locked out with no physical key backup. We always recommend maintaining a mechanical override, and we can install one if your smart lock didn’t include it.
- Keyway jamming from construction dust. In Buckeye’s massive new developments, builder crews leave debris that solidifies in the cylinder. New homeowners call us within months of closing, key barely turning. We flush the cylinder and cut clean keys - but we also check whether the lock itself was damaged by forced rotation.
- Obsolete keyways in older homes. The pre-1980 agricultural-era ranch homes in 85326 often use lock brands no longer manufactured. We stock skeleton key blanks and can retrofit modern Schlage or Medeco hardware that preserves your door’s appearance while providing current security.
Pricing for Emergency Locksmith in Buckeye, AZ
We quote flat prices on the phone before any work begins. No bait, no switch.
| Service | Typical Range in Buckeye |
|---|---|
| House lockout (business hours) | $89-$145 |
| House lockout (after hours / weekend) | $129-$185 |
| Broken key extraction | $75-$140 |
| Lock rekey (per cylinder) | $25-$45 |
| Safe opening (non-destructive) | $150-$350 |
| Safe opening (drilling required) | $250-$500 |
| Lock replacement (standard deadbolt) | $140-$280 |
| High-security lock upgrade (Medeco/Abloy) | $280-$480 |
What moves the needle: after-hours timing, safe complexity, and whether your hardware is standard or obsolete. Our $89 Seasonal Tune-Up catches binding issues before they become lockouts. No. Rekeying changes the internal pin combination so old keys no longer work; we reuse your existing hardware. In Buckeye’s 85396 ZIP, where nearly every home has the same builder-supplied Kwikset or Schlage keysets, rekeying is the cost-effective choice. We charge $25-$45 per cylinder. If your hardware is damaged or you want higher security, then we replace. We quote both options on the phone so you can decide.
